The Men Who Pickled Lenin

Thursday 15 April, 7pm – 8.30pm, FREE

The Space, Nottingham Contemporary

USSR, 1924: With Lenin dead, Stalin looks to fill the power vacuum and tighten his grasp on a Communist future. To create a Bolshevik god under his control, Uncle Joe decrees the corpse must be preserved. Permanently.
The Committee for Immortalization hand the job to scientists Boris Zbarsky and Vladimir Vorobiov. They have one chance to perfect a technique never attempted before. Meanwhile, the world’s first Soviet leader is already starting to rot...

The Men Who Pickled Lenin is a work-in-progress presentation of a unique open-source writing collaboration, devised by Hatch’s Nathaniel J Miller and performed inside the belly of a cosmonaut.
